Edna Burton

Patient advocate supervisor

Edna Sue Burton, 60, of Langdon Street, Somerset, died Monday, Dec. 11, 2006, at Lake Cumberland Regional Hospital, Somerset.

She was born in Burnside, Ky., on July 25, 1946, a daughter of the late George W. and Delta Troxell Latham. She was a retired patient advocate supervisor of Cottage 6 at the Communities of Oakwood. She was a wonderful wife, homemaker, sister, mother, and grandmother. She was also a member of West Bronston Baptist Church for more than 20 years.

Survivors include two sons, Michael Burton and Joe R. Burton, both of Somerset; two brothers, Ralph H. (and Mary Sue) Latham of Bronston and David (and Dolly) Latham of Somerset; a half brother, Charles (and Darlene) Latham of Sloans Valley, Ky.; two sisters, Betty (and Baxter) Wells of Monticello, Ky. and Phyllis (and Clifton) Gibson of Somerset; two half sisters, Carolyn Latham and Georgia Latham, both of Tateville, Ky.; the light of her life, her granddaughter, Chelsea Leshea Burton; and two other grandchildren, Mark Moody and Michelle Moody, both of Gainesville, Fla.

She was preceded in death by her parents; her husband, Joseph Lee Burton; three brothers, George Latham Jr., Fred Latham, and Jack Latham; two half brothers, Norman Latham and Eugene Latham; three sisters, Grace Walden, Juanita Lawson, and Iva Lee Latham; and a half sister, Linda Latham.

A funeral service will be held Friday, Dec. 15, at 2 p.m. at Lake Cumberland Funeral Home with Bro. Wayne Bowling officiating.

Burial will be in the Latham Family Cemetery in Bronston.

Friends may call Thursday, Dec. 14, after 5 p.m. at the funeral home.
